I am thinking of expanding my plumbing set-up. Is it ok to mix and match unions from different manufacturers?

Thanks

superedge88
07/14/2007, 10:18 AM
I have done this before, just make sure that the union tightens down like it should and that the gasket is being pressed and things should be ok. There are some unions that will not match up correctly with other halves, so make sure or you will have leaking problems.

Match the brands. In PVC it should be ok due to the rubber O ring. Any metal to metal (for plumbing use) should never be mismatched. Always change the whole union on copper or black pipe.
